[QUOTE="mandkole, post: 724286, member: 4630"] I found nothing laggy with a decent 1.15 housing stocker and stage 1s. Still does not seem like you have everything figured out yet, or the turbo is dead. If you want to redo a stock turbo, just find a 1.00 housing and run it. I liked the towing manners of my stocker in the OBS, versus the GT42 in the same conditions. Dont misunderstand, the GT42 rips but its a different animal with 10K on its back and takes rpm. No need for an auto, but with a manual you cant lug it. It would be like having the converter locked on an auto all the time. [/QUOTE]
